I am having a very productive evening convincing DH to re-book on board!! Has anyone doen that? Can you only do it at certain times / days in the cruise?
We did last time (for this one!) and might rebook again. The booking desk is only open certain times (noted in the Navigator, I think, or else just on a sign at the booking desk), and you can also send a request to have the booking agent get it started for you so you don't have to do as much when you actually talk to her. The lines can get kind of long, though. The earlier in the week that you go, the less busy it is. We waited until either Thurs or Fri, and I had it on my plan for the day to be there when she started. Of course, a line had started to form already when I got there (before she got there), but I didn't have to wait too long. By the time I was done, though, it was getting busy!

Will there be enough time to meet the driver at 8:30 if we are able to get on one of the first tenders? Has anyone had any problems getting on the 7:30 tender if they do not have an excursion booked through Disney? I emailed the rep that we booked our tour with and she said that we should be just fine. I just want to be sure!!!!
We got on the 7:30 AM tender last time. The meeting place for non-DCL excursions was in the Buena Vista Theater (deck 5 aft), and after the first DCL excursion tender left, then they came for us. We were one of the last ones that got on the first boat. I think they have tenders pretty much nonstop (not just one boat going back & forth). We had plenty of time to meet at 8:30. (I can't remember which company are you going with, but if it's Cap'n Marvin's, the office is about 5 or so blocks away. BTW, if you want to take DCL towels for your excursion, you'll need to go to deck 9 and get them first before getting to the theater. I was under the impression that they would have them to hand out to us, but I think that's only for the DCL excursions. Justin was running up there last minute to get our towels as they came for us!
